How much do excel trainer j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 8, 2026, the average hourly pay for excel trainer in Arizona is $25.19,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$17.69 and $29.13 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some common challenges Excel trainers face when teaching diverse groups, and how can they be addressed?

Excel Trainers often work with learners who have varying skill levels, learning speeds, and backgrounds. One common challenge is ensuring that both beginners and advanced users remain engaged and supported throughout the training. To address this, trainers typically assess participants' proficiency levels beforehand, tailor sessions to include practical examples relevant to different roles, and provide supplementary materials or breakout activities. Effective communication, patience, and flexibility are key to creating an inclusive learning environment where all attendees can succeed.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Excel trainer,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Excel Trainer, you need advanced proficiency in Microsoft Excel, a strong understanding of data analysis, and experience in instructional design or adult education. Familiarity with Excel’s advanced features—such as pivot tables, macros, Power Query, and relevant Microsoft Office Specialist (MOS) certifications—is highly valued. Exceptional communication, patience, and adaptability help trainers effectively convey complex concepts and tailor sessions to diverse learners. These skills ensure trainees gain practical Excel expertise, leading to improved productivity and data-driven decision-making within organizations.

What is an Excel trainer?

An Excel Trainer is a professional who specializes in teaching individuals or groups how to use Microsoft Excel effectively. They design and deliver training sessions covering a range of topics, from basic spreadsheet navigation to advanced functions like data analysis, formulas, and automation with macros. Excel Trainers may work for corporate clients, educational institutions, or offer freelance services, tailoring their instruction to different skill levels. Their goal is to help learners become proficient and efficient in using Excel for various business or personal tasks.

What is the difference between Excel Trainer vs Data Analyst?

AspectExcel TrainerData Analyst
Required CredentialsExcel certifications, training experienceDegree in data-related fields, certifications like SQL or Tableau
Work EnvironmentTraining sessions, workshops, corporate trainingData analysis, reporting, business intelligence
Employer & Industry UsageEducational institutions, corporate training firmsBusinesses, finance, marketing, healthcare

While both roles involve working with data, an Excel Trainer primarily focuses on teaching Excel skills to individuals or groups, often in training settings. A Data Analyst uses Excel along with other tools to analyze data, generate reports, and support decision-making. The roles overlap in Excel proficiency but differ in scope and purpose.
